Look mate, this isn't homerism. I truly believe Kaep has one of the best arms in the NFL. I think he can do things other QBs can't. The offense as a whole is having a down year due to injuries and an offensive coordinator who is Jekyll and Hyde when it comes to calling plays. We don't call screens. We don't run many slants. Part of this is because Kaep is learning what kind of QB he is. At the present moment he is having trouble making touch passes and is forcing throws into coverage. He's doing it lot. This is what is accounting for his completion percentage. I also can't stress this enough. He has had two targets all year. Two. Those two targets may be hall of fame caliber targets but there are 11 defenders out there. For the beginning of the season, Kaep has had only one read because he doesn't trust the rest of his receiving corps. Jon Baldwin has been on the team for three months and has like three catches. Kyle Williams had ten in six games as a starter. It has contributed to his stats being sh*t this year.

All I'm saying is that as a football player...stats aside, Kaep is legit. He has a rocket arm and can't make tight as sh*t throws. I've seen every game he's ever played. I'm not being a homer.
